CHINESE ORANGE BEEF



Chinese Orange Beef image

Cook a quick meal with this tasty stir-fry, which combines tender steak with a flavourful citrus sauce.

Provided by English_Rose

Categories     Meat

Time 20m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 1/2 lbs sirloin steaks, trimmed and cut into strips
1 tablespoon cornstarch, for tossing
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1 garlic clove, chopped
1 orange, juice of
1 dash dark soy sauce
1 bunch scallion, chopped
noodles, ideally Chinese

Steps:

  • Toss the steak in a little cornstarch.
  • Heat the vegetable oil in a non-stick frying pan.
  • Stir-fry beef strips in small batches for about 2 minutes, until browned. Remove the beef and set aside.
  • Add the garlic, orange juice and soy sauce and bring to the boil.
  • Return the beef to the pan, add the scallions and heat through.
  • Meanwhile, cook the noodles in a large pan of boiling water following packet instructions. Tip into a colander and drain.
  • Serve the beef on a bed of piping-hot cooked noodles.

SPICY ORANGE BISON BALLS



Spicy Orange Bison Balls image

This recipe is inspired by the retro classic cocktail meatballs in grape jelly. I took that idea, along with my love of spicy orange beef, and came up with this combination.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Spicy

Time 1h30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 pound ground bison
2 cloves garlic, minced
½ cup plain breadcrumbs
1 egg, beaten
½ te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
2 tablespoons Asian chile pepper sauce
½ cup orange marmalade
1 tablespoon soy sauce
¼ cup rice vinegar
3 cups water

Steps:

  • Mix the bison, garlic, breadcrumbs, egg,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per in a large mixing bowl until evenly combined; divide the mixture into 24 portions and roll into balls.
  • Heat the v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at; cook the meatballs until nicely browned on all sides, 7 to 10 minutes.
  • Add the chili sauce, orange marmalade, soy sauce, rice vinegar, and water to the skillet. Bring the mixture to a simmer, reduce heat to medium-low, and cook until the sauce thickens, about 1 hour.

SPICY ORANGE ZEST BEEF



Spicy Orange Zest Beef image

This spicy orange zest beef recipe is not supposed to be Chinese food, or even Americanized Chinese take-out food. It is a lower-fat alternative while still a quick, easy, and surprisingly flavorful meal.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     Asian     Chinese

Time 2h

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 pound beef tenderloin, cut into 1/2 inch strips
¼ cup orange juice
¼ cup seasoned rice vinegar
2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on hot chile paste (such as sambal oelek)
1 tablespoon brown sugar, or to taste
2 cloves garlic, minced
¼ cup water
1 teaspoon cornstarch
cooking spray
2 tablespoons grated orange zest
1 bunch green onions, sliced - white parts and tops separated
sal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Combine beef, orange juice, rice vinegar, soy sauce, hot chili paste, brown sugar, and garlic in a large bowl. Cover and refrigerate for 1 to 2 hours.
  • Strain beef in a colander set over a large bowl, allowing beef to drain thoroughly, about 5 minutes. Reserve marinade.
  • Stir water and cornstarch into the bowl of marinade. Whisk until cornstarch is dissolved, set aside.
  • Spray skillet with cooking spray and place over high heat. Cook beef for 1 minute without stirring; cook and stir for an additional minute.
  • Stir in light parts of green onion and orange zest; cook for 30 seconds.
  • Stir in marinade and green onion tops; cook and stir until beef is no longer pink inside and sauce is reduced and thick, about 2 to 3 minutes.
  • Season with salt and black pepper to taste.

MONGOLIAN BEEF MEATBALLS



Mongolian Beef Meatballs image

Everything you love about Mongolian beef, but in meatball form! This is a quick easy dinner that pairs well with rice or Chinese noodles.

Provided by Arlyn Osborne

Categories     Meatballs

Time 55m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 large egg
1 tablespoon hoisin sauce
1 tablespoon low sodium soy sauce
2 teaspoons grated garlic
1 teaspoon grated ginger
3 scallions, finely chopped
1 1/4 cups panko breadcrumbs
1 1/2 lbs ground beef
1 cup dark brown sugar
1/2 cup low sodium soy sauce
1/3 cup hoisin sauce
1 tablespoon sesame oil
2 teaspoons grated garlic
1/2 teaspoon grated ginger
1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es
2 teaspoons cornstarch
4 cups cooked rice
1/4 cup sliced scallion
2 tablespoons toasted sesame seeds

Steps:

  • For the meatballs: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F and line a sheet tray with parchment paper.
  • Beat the egg in a large bowl with a fork, then add the hoisin sauce, soy sauce, garlic, ginger and scallions. Stir in the panko, then add the ground beef, tearing into small pieces before adding to the bowl.
  • Mix together by hand until completely combined, then use a 1-tablespoon ice cream scoop or spoon to make meatballs and place on the prepared baking sheet. Shape the meatballs into smooth round balls. Bake until cooked through, 15 to 17 minutes.
  • For the sauce: Whisk to combine the dark brown sugar, soy sauce, hoisin sauce, sesame oil, garlic, ginger, red pepper flakes and 1 cup water in a large skillet. Bring to a simmer and cook until the sugar is dissolved and the sauce is thickened, 6 to 8 minutes.
  • Whisk the cornstarch with 1 tablespoon water in a small bowl until smooth. Stir into the simmering sauce, then add the cooked meatballs and cook until the sauce is thickened and the meatballs are coated, about 30 seconds.
  • For the rice and garnishes: Serve the meatballs over rice and garnish with sliced scallions and toasted sesame seeds.
